A while ago, Adventures in Missions (AIM) proposed a backup plan, a modified gap year. Now, that backup plan has solidified and become the new plan because of the way that the coronavirus has affected travel. Because travel bans aren’t likely to be lifted by september, the new plan is to launch January 2nd.

So, what are we doing in that 3 month period before we launch?

We will be staying at the AIM base in Georgia for an extended training period! This will involve missional training, discipleship, and leadership development. After this, we will still get to travel for 6 months (WOOT WOOT)!! We will most likely get to go to the same amount of countries as planned before, although the exact countries are still up in the air.
